How to Protect your Arduino Design Part 2

In this two part series we look at how to protect your Arduino against different forms of electrical damage and ensure your design is electrically rugged. In part 2 we focus on how to protect against ESD damage with TVS diodes.

How to Protect your Arduino Design (Electrically) Part 1

In this video we look at how to protect your Arduino against different forms of electrical damage and ensure your design is electrically rugged. We will be looking at parts such as current limiting resistors, zenor diodes, and schottky barrier diodes.
